[Aurora Season]
✅ The aurora can be seen year-round in Tasmania, with a higher probability from April to September.
✅ About the Aurora: The southern lights seen in Tasmania are mostly pink and purple. Due to the proton aurora phenomenon, you can see pink and purple dancing lights with a KP index of 3.
✅ Viewing Conditions: KP index greater than 5, clear skies, and away from city lights.
[Chasing the Lights Guide]
☑️ Aurora Forecast: The IPS Australian Space Weather Services provides real-time data. A geomagnetic storm index of G1 is sufficient.
⏰ Best Time to Chase: Set out between 7 PM and 9 PM. The peak aurora activity is usually between 10 PM and 2 AM.
📲 Essential Apps: My Aurora Forecast and Aurora to check detailed aurora indices. Use both apps for cross-verification.
💻 Essential Websites: Check real-time weather on the Bureau of Meteorology (BOM) and Windy for weather and cloud maps.
💡 PS: Join Facebook groups like Aurora Australis Tasmania for timely aurora sighting information.
[Aurora Viewing Spots]
Rosny Hill: Feel the aurora up close.
Taroona Beach: The closest beach to Hobart for aurora chasing.
Cradle Mountain: Perfect view with the aurora reflecting on the lake.
Mount Wellington: Unobstructed view of the aurora.
Bruny Island: Popular spots include the lighthouse and The Neck.
Maria Island: Zero light pollution, a truly pristine island.

[Aurora Photography Tips]
📷 Camera: Manual mode, ISO 800+, shutter speed 10-20 seconds, manual focus to infinity.
📱 Phone: Night mode + long exposure.
